Urban, Suburban and Family Agriculture Program in Las Tunas

The Urban, Suburban, and Family Agriculture Program has the challenge of incorporating about 100 thousand hectares into production in 2024, distributed in the eight municipalities of Las province.

La Herradura 1 wind farm, on the northern coast of Las Tunas

The civil construction of the La Herradura 1 wind farm, on the northern coast of Las Tunas, reached 2024 with significant progress, thanks to the systematic work of the province's Construction and Assembly Company.

Jaime Ernesto Chiang Vega, provincial governor, presented the report to the Parliament.

The National Assembly of the People's Power approved the accountability report of the government of this eastern Cuban province before the legislature, presented by Jaime Ernesto Chiang Vega, provincial governor, although he made several points that require urgent attention by local authorities and the central state administration.
